2012 Women's Soccer Roster

2 Jill Dozier

  • Class Senior
  • Highschool Fallston
  • Hometown Fallston, Md.

Biography

2012: Finished her career fifth on Lafayette[apos]s all time points and goals list (18 goals, 41 points)...tied for fourth on the Leopards all time list for games played with 71...named First Team All Patriot League...appeared in all 18 games drawing 17 starts...led the Leopards with nine goals while also tallying two assists on the season...scored two goals against St. Peters (9/2) and Colgate (10/19)...scored the game-winning goal against Lehigh (9/29)...Patriot League Academic Honor Roll.

2011:
Appeared in all 17 games, making 16 starts...had a goal and two assists on the year...assisted the game-winning tally in double-overtime against Howard (8/30)...had an assist on the lone goal in a victory against NJIT (9/11)...found the back of the net in a 2-2 draw at Princeton (9/21)...Patriot League Academic Honor Roll selection.

2010: Appeared in all 18 games and made six starts at forward for the Leopards...led the team with six goals and 12 points during her sophomore campaign...registered the decisive tally in double overtime against Wagner (8/29)...netted both goals in a 2-0 win at Bryant (9/10)...found the back of the net in a victory over NJIT (9/17)...scored off the bench against Colgate (10/10).

2009: Named to the Patriot League Academic Honor Roll...played in all 18 games including nine starts...scored a goal in a 4-0 win against Delaware State (9/4)...found the back of the net and added an assist at Loyola (Md.) (9/6).

At Fallston: Served as team captain...led her team to a state finals appearance in 2008 and a regional finals trip in 2007...selected to the Maryland All-State Second Team...named Harford County First Team and UCBAC First Team in 2008...helped her club team to the state finals in 2006...led her team in scoring at the Gothia Cup in Gotenburg, Sweden with eight goals in four games...holds school record in the long jump and 100 meter as a member of the track and field team...member of the National and Spanish Honor Societies...AP Scholar...named to the Honor Roll and Minds in Motion.

Why Lafayette?:'I chose Lafayette because of its campus atmosphere, dedication to academics and the opportunity to play Division I soccer. It[apos]s a great fit for me academically and athletically.'
